Common LiftMaster Garage Door Problems We Solve in Savage

  • MyQ connectivity loss in river-valley humidity. Savage sits lower than Columbia or Laurel, and that trapped moisture gets into router circuitry and opener Wi-Fi boards. We see LiftMaster 85503 and 8500W units dropping off networks seasonally — not from defective hardware, but from condensation cycling. We re-pair systems, relocate routers when possible, and recommend humidity-resistant placement.
  • Torsion spring rust from persistent condensation. The Little Patuxent valley holds morning moisture longer than surrounding terrain. LiftMaster-equipped doors in Savage’s historic district need spring replacement more frequently than Howard County averages suggest — we catch this before a snapped spring damages the opener or door.
  • Battery backup drain on cold, damp mornings. The 8500W wall-mount’s internal batteries lose capacity faster in Savage’s microclimate than in drier areas. We test actual reserve capacity, not just charge-light status, and replace cells before you get trapped with a power outage and a dead backup.
  • Sprocket wear from misaligned historic tracks. Belt-drive LiftMasters like the 8365W and 87504 depend on precise track geometry. Foundation settling in Savage’s 1800s garages throws off alignment, grinding the belt and jerking the carriage. We don’t just swap the belt — we realign the track system to protect the new one.
  • Non-standard rail fitment in low-clearance garages. Sub-7-foot headers in mill-era cottages require shortened rail kits and relocated sensor brackets. We’ve configured LiftMaster 87504 units for these spaces with custom bracketry that maintains full safety compliance.

LiftMaster Service in Savage: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ment

Savage’s historic mill-era garages often have non-standard 7-foot headers and narrow widths — requiring custom LiftMaster rail shortcuts and sensor bracket relocation not seen in typical Howard County suburban installations, a fact owners of 1820s-1870s rowhouses know well. In the surrounding 1980s–2000s developments, a standard 9-foot or 16-foot opening takes a catalog Riverside LiftMaster service install. But in the historic district off Foundry Street, we’ve measured garages where a full-length 8500W rail would punch through the roofline. We keep shortened rail kits and adjustable sensor brackets in stock specifically for these Savage retrofits. The river-valley humidity compounds everything: a garage that breathes damp air all summer will corrode LiftMaster safety sensors faster, warp wooden door sections that stress the opener, and degrade battery chemistry. We account for this in our maintenance recommendations — not generic schedules, but intervals calibrated to what we’ve observed in Savage’s specific microclimate.
